STEP 11. Using the oscilloscope, check the No. 5 cylinder 
injector.
(1) Disconnect the intermediate connector B-32 and connect 

the test harness MB991658 between the separated 
connectors.

(2) Connect the oscilloscope probe to injector intermediate 

connector terminal No. 4.

NOTE: When measuring with the ECU side connector, dis-
connect the all ECU connectors and connect check harness 
special tool (MB992044) between the separated connec-
tors. Then connect an oscilloscope probe to the check har-
ness connector terminal No. 16.

(3) Start the engine and run at idle.

(4) Measure the waveform.

• The waveform should show a normal pattern similar to 

the illustration.

(5) Turn the ignition switch to the "LOCK" (OFF) position.

Q: Is the waveform normal?

YES : It can be assumed that this malfunction is intermittent. 

Refer to GROUP 00, How to Use 
Troubleshooting/Inspection Service Points 

− How to 

Cope with Intermittent Malfunctions 

P.00-14

.

NO :  Replace the ECU. Then go to Step 12.

STEP 12. Test the EOBD drive cycle.
(1) Carry out a test drive with the drive cycle pattern. Refer to 

Diagnostic Function 

− EOBD Drive Cycle −

P.13A-11

.

(2) Check the diagnostic trouble code (DTC).

Q: Is DTC P0205 set?

YES : Retry the troubleshooting.
NO :  The inspection is complete.

DTC P0206: Injector Circuit Malfunction - Cylinder 6.

.

CIRCUIT OPERATION

• Refer to DTC P0300 - Random/Multiple Misfire- 

P.13A-330

 and Misfire Cylinder 6- 

P.13A-344

.

• The injector power is supplied from the MPI relay 

(terminal No. 4).

• The ECU controls the injector by turning the 

power transistor in the ECU "ON" and "OFF".

.

TECHNICAL DESCRIPTION

• The amount of fuel injected by the injector is con-

trolled by the amount of continuity time the coil is 
grounded by the ECU.

• A surge voltage is generated when the injectors 

are switched on/off.

• The ECU monitors this surge voltage.

.

DTC SET CONDITIONS <Circuit continuity 

 open circuit and shorted low>

Check Conditions

• Battery voltage is between 9.04 and 16.01vols.

• Engine speed is above 801 r/min.

Judgment Criteria

• IC internal test (open circuit, short to earth, short 

to battery). 

• MIL on after 2 drive cycles.

• Misfire present.

.

TROUBLESHOOTING HINTS (The most 
likely causes for this code to be set are:)

• No. 6 cylinder injector failed.

• Open or shorted to ground No.6 cylinder injector 

circuit.

• Shorted to battery, No.6 cylinder injector circuit.

• Harness or connector damage.

DIAGNOSIS

Required Special Tools:

• Diagnostic Tool (MUT-III Sub Assembly)

• MB991824: V.C.I.

• MB991827: USB Cable

• MB991910: Main Harness A

• MB991658: Test Harness
• MB992044: Power Plant ECU Check Harness

STEP 1. Using diagnostic tool , check actuator test item 02, 
04, 06: No. 6 injector.

CAUTION

To prevent damage to diagnostic tool , always turn the 
ignition switch to the "LOCK" (OFF) position before con-
necting or disconnecting diagnostic tool .
(1) Connect diagnostic tool to the data link connector.
(2) Start the engine and run at idle.
(3) Set diagnostic tool to the actuator testing mode for item 06, 

No. 6 Injector.

(4) Warm up the engine to normal operating temperature: 80

°C 

to 95

°C (176°F to 203°F).

• The idle should become slightly rougher.

(5) Turn the ignition switch to the "LOCK" (OFF) position.

Q: Does the idle vary or engine run "rough"?

YES : It can be assumed that this malfunction is intermittent. 

Refer to GROUP 00, How to Use 
Troubleshooting/Inspection Service Points 

− How to 

Cope with Intermittent Malfunctions 

P.00-14

.

NO :  Go to Step 2.

STEP 2. Check the harness connector B-26 at No. 6 
cylinder injector for damage.
Q: Is the harness connector in good condition?

YES : Go to Step 3.
NO :  Repair or replace it. Refer to GROUP 00E, Harness 

Connector Inspection 

P.00E-2

. Then go to Step 10.
